Unity of Spiritual and Secular Scripture
- The Bible's spiritual and secular content cannot be separated without undermining its authority.
- Biblical revelation is rooted in historical events that validate theological truths.
The Gospel is Everywhere in Scripture
- The entire Bible, all 66 books, are interconnected and reveal the gospel.
- Limiting Scripture to just the gospel message overlooks the Bible's broader revelatory purpose.
Cloaks Concealing Denial of Inerrancy
- Hermeneutics, church teaching, and pneumatology can be misused to deny biblical inerrancy.
- Errors in interpretation or authority claims undermine confidence in Scripture's truthfulness.
